OVS Al-Rashid Mall

RASHID MALL LAND FLOOR - GATE 3 ALBADEA, 5258 Abha Arabie Saoudite

OVS Al-Rashid Mall RASHID MALL LAND FLOOR - GATE 3 ALBADEA, Abha

Indications